Update quickfix mapping to open location list

Enhance the quickfix mapping to open the location list
after setting all hunks, improving user experience.
This commit is contained in:
Ray Elliott 2026-01-13 15:39:03 +00:00
parent 1b71a30520
commit 70d28cbb3f
1 changed files with 4 additions and 1 deletions

View File

@ -51,7 +51,10 @@ return {
map('n', '<leader>hD', function() gs.diffthis('~') end, { desc = 'Gitsigns: Diff this ~' }) map('n', '<leader>hD', function() gs.diffthis('~') end, { desc = 'Gitsigns: Diff this ~' })
-- Quickfix/Location list -- Quickfix/Location list
map('n', '<leader>hq', function() gs.setqflist('all') end, { desc = 'Gitsigns: All hunks to quickfix' }) map('n', '<leader>hq', function()
gs.setqflist('all')
vim.cmd('copen')
end, { desc = 'Gitsigns: All hunks to quickfix' })
-- Text object -- Text object
map({ 'o', 'x' }, 'ih', ':<C-U>Gitsigns select_hunk<CR>', { desc = 'Gitsigns: Select hunk' }) map({ 'o', 'x' }, 'ih', ':<C-U>Gitsigns select_hunk<CR>', { desc = 'Gitsigns: Select hunk' })